[QUOTE="mojo1029, post: 911833, member: 76679"] Trigger guard - yes. Floor plate - no. You don't really need one. If you take the stock off and try to slide in the magazine, you'll see that the magazine doesn't rely on the stock to lock in. With the Boyd stock, it slides and locks in place (I had to do a little woodwork to get mine to slide in enough, but it eventually worked. [/QUOTE]
